Pros

Good pay, Flex Schedule (you can take every other Friday off) Reasonable benefits (not the best but I will count it in pros)

Cons

Let me list the easy ones first: Richmond!! No natural room for growth Now, let's get to the real con: The main theme of the company is let's be snobby (a typical East Coast culture). There are so many youngsters, with a few years of experience, who happen to lead most the engineering groups. They believe that they know it all. They are not willing to listen to, nor respect others with real years of experience from much larger organizations that dealt with large scale real projects and problems.

Pros

Consistently good compensation and benefits. Mostly friendly employees but shifting to less collaborative environment due to limited advancement opportunities

Cons

Limited leadership opportunities, lack of transparency for promotional opportunities. Upper management easily circumvents HR polices to place their candidates of choice
